In this heartfelt sermon, we revisit the story of Zacchaeus—a wealthy, isolated tax collector who climbs a tree just to catch a glimpse of Jesus. What follows is a powerful moment of grace, healing, and transformation. Through personal stories, humor, and reflection, this message reminds us that Jesus sees those who feel unseen, calls us by name, and invites us into relationship. No one is too far gone, too broken, or too lost. Jesus still says, “I’m coming to your house today.”
